Michael Schneider Variety Editor at Large The Television Critics Association has canceled its planned Winter 2025 TCA press tour, after it failed to reach a critical mass of networks, studios and streamers willing to participate in the semi-annual event.
It’s the latest blow to the TCA organization, which has struggled to front a robust press tour in recent years following the double whammy of the COVID-19 pandemic, followed by the dual Hollywood strikes.
In a letter to TCA members, Television Critics Assoc. president Jacqueline Cutler blamed the cancellation on Hollywood’s “deep contraction.
While several streamers, networks, and studios committed, it was not enough for a full press tour. We wanted to be respectful of our members’ need to plan so, as a board, we decided on an early November deadline to make this decision.” Cutler added that the TCA plans to hold a Summer 2025 tour, and that executives are still “working toward” returning to that event.
